Inside Out 2 is officially the biggest movie of the year in North America! After premiering on June 14, the sequel to Pixar’s 2015 smash hit has become a major box office success. Things were going so well, that it was drawing comparisons to Barbie, the top-grossing movie of 2023. With a second week in theaters, Inside Out 2 pulled in enough to overcome the closest competition for the year. Keep reading to find out more… According to Variety, the animated movie hit $285.7 million in sales in North America. That pushed it past Dune: Part Two, which brought in $282 million. The new record-holder achieved the feat in only eight days. The outlet noted that Inside Out 2 might manage to earn more than $92.3 million in its second full weekend. If it does so, that’ll push it past The Super Mario Bros. Movie‘s record as the animated movie with the top-grossing second weekend. From Friday night (June 21) alone, the movie brought in $30.5 million.
